Jan. 19, 2002
Carbondale, Ill. - Currently on an eight-game losing streak, Southern Illinois (4-11, 0-6) will close out its brief two-game homestand Sunday afternoon when the Salukis host Illinois State (3-12, 1-5) at 2:05 p.m.
Southern Illinois and Illinois State have battled to a 38-37 mark in its overall series which stands in favor of the Salukis. The Dawgs posted a two-game sweep over the Redbirds last season and have won their last six of seven games over ISU.
SIU is still searching for its first league win of the 2001-02 campaign as the Salukis rank last in the Valley. Coming off a heartbreaking 71-65 loss to Indiana State on Thursday, the Dawgs are led by junior Molly McDowell who is averaging 13.4 points per game. McDowell scored 13 points against the Sycamores to post her 13th game scoring in double figures this season.
Following McDowell is Holly Teague who saw her average drop to 12.9 points per game after a nine-point performance against Indiana State. Despite her quiet nine points, Teague was solid on the boards, however, where she pulled down 10 rebounds. Geshla Woodard then rounds out the Dawgs' top three scoring 9.8 points to go along with 6.8 rebounds.
Like SIU, ninth-place Illinois State has had its share of losses this season. Losing five of their last six games, ISU is led by sophomore guard Taren O'Brien (9.3 ppg) as the Redbirds do not have one player scoring in double figures this season. O'Brien is followed by Kristi Larson who is averaging 8.3 points per game and Stacey White who is netting 7.9.
